What does an SSL Certificate mean for Your Website?

Used by millions of websites daily, SSL (Secure Socket Layer) applies encryption to secure traffic on the internet and protect sensitive customer information. Moreover, an SSL authenticates that the site you’re visiting is the actual genuine site. It’s visible as a padlock and an “HTTPS” protocol on the address bar.

SSL certificate will be issued by Domain control validation or verifying business entity process that may involve thorough automated domain validation or full business control validation.  

Domain Validation (DV) SSL certificate requires automated domain control validation to migrate your site into HTTPS protocol, whereas identity verification of your company can be possible through Organisation validation SSL certificate.

Domain validation, as well as Rigorous business identity verification, offers high assurance and fully trusted site with the use of Extended Validation SSL certificate.

SSL certificate establishes encrypted connections from your web server to your clients’ browser through three key ways:

    • Preventing 3rd parties from intercepting, tracking and stealing data from your website visitors’ activity.
    • Preserving data integrity by preventing transferred files from being corrupted.
    • Establishing trustworthiness of your website through an authentication process.

 

How SSL/ TLS Protected Websites Improve Customer Experience

The data protection provided by SSL transforms the way customers interact with and perceive your website.

  1. Website users don’t get unwanted intrusive ads and cookies

Without SSL, an ISP or Hotspot can inject content onto your site, including extra cookies and ads. Apart from the fact that you wouldn’t be getting paid for such ads, users on your website would be irritated by the intrusive content. They might not realize that such content doesn’t come from your website server, giving them a bad perception of your site.

  1. Your clients avoid phishing attacks

Phishing attacks often spoof target sites. However, phishers can’t reproduce your company’s EV SSL certificate, making it possible to quickly differentiate a spoof website from the genuine one. This saves your clients from suffering phishing attacks that masquerade as your company.

  1. SSL ensures user privacy

Users can be assured that their sensitive information on your SSL protected website won’t be leaked or intercepted. This is because SSL authentication and encryption secure connections between clients and your website server. This way, clients would be more willing to provide detailed personal information and frequently use your website.

  1. Clients enjoy uninterrupted service delivery

As SSL secures your website, email communications, email to server connections and server to server connections, it ensures continuity of business operations. This means clients would also enjoy continuous service delivery without any interruption. They will come to trust your company to always be reliable and dependable.
